Frame material affects sightlines, finish, maintenance and structural design, but material name alone does not establish thermal performance or durability. Compare complete systems with like-for-like glazing, reinforcement, coatings and guarantees.

Material Often chosen for Check in the specification
uPVC Lower-maintenance mainstream systems Reinforcement, profile depth, colour stability
Aluminium Slimmer sightlines and larger openings Thermal break, coating and coastal exposure
Timber Natural finish and repairability Species, treatment, detailing and maintenance cycle

Ask for colour samples in daylight and details for junctions, drainage paths and replacement parts. Maintenance claims should state the expected task and conditions rather than “maintenance-free”.

FAQs

Do slim frames automatically mean better thermal performance?

No. Sightline and heat flow are different characteristics. Compare declared performance for the complete frame-and-glass configuration.

How does ongoing maintenance differ between materials?

Timber finishes usually need planned inspection and renewal; coated aluminium and uPVC need cleaning and hardware/drainage care. Exposure and product instructions matter.
